Car
If you are driving, head towards Breitenbrunn from Neusiedl am See. Take the B50 road towards Breitenbrunn. After approximately 15 minutes, follow the signs for Breitenbrunn. Once you enter the town, turn onto Yachtclubstraße. The Lighthouse is located at Yachtclub 5, which is near the lakeside. There is parking available nearby.
Public Transportation
To reach the Lighthouse via public transport, take the train from Neusiedl am See to Breitenbrunn. The train journey takes about 10 minutes. Once you arrive at Breitenbrunn station, exit the station and walk towards Yachtclubstraße, which is approximately a 20-minute walk. Follow the signs towards the lake, and the Lighthouse will be at Yachtclub 5.
Bicycle
For a more scenic route, consider cycling from Neusiedl am See to Breitenbrunn. You can rent a bicycle in Neusiedl if you do not have one. The ride will take about 30-40 minutes. Follow the lakeside path towards Breitenbrunn, enjoying the views along the way. Once you reach Breitenbrunn, head to Yachtclubstraße, and you will find the Lighthouse at Yachtclub 5. There are bike racks available for parking your bicycle.
